In my latest blog post, I explored the science behind heartburn and what happens in our bodies when we experience it. I learned that heartburn occurs when stomach acid flows back into the esophagus, causing that all-too-familiar burning sensation. This is usually due to a weakened or dysfunctional lower esophageal sphincter, which is meant to keep stomach acid in its place. I also discovered that certain lifestyle factors, such as diet and stress, can play a significant role in causing heartburn. It's fascinating to understand the science behind this common yet painful condition, and I hope my readers find it helpful in managing their symptoms.
As a blogger, I recently came across the topic of Teriflunomide drug interactions and thought it would be important to share my findings. Teriflunomide, a drug used to treat multiple sclerosis, can interact with various medications, potentially leading to serious side effects. Some of these drugs include warfarin, leflunomide, and certain vaccines. It's essential for patients to consult with their healthcare providers before starting any new medications to avoid any harmful interactions. Always stay informed and vigilant when it comes to your medications, as it can make a significant difference in your overall health and well-being.

In my recent blog post, I explored the connection between dry mouth and oral thrush. I found that both conditions share common symptoms, such as discomfort and difficulty swallowing. Interestingly, dry mouth can actually contribute to the development of oral thrush since it creates an ideal environment for the Candida fungus to grow. To prevent and manage these conditions, maintaining proper oral hygiene and staying hydrated are essential. Overall, understanding this connection is crucial for maintaining good oral health and avoiding complications.

As a blogger, I've recently been researching the role of azelaic acid in treating hyperpigmentation. I've discovered that azelaic acid is a naturally occurring substance that has been proven effective in reducing dark spots and uneven skin tone. It works by targeting the overactive pigment-producing cells, ultimately helping to even out the complexion. I also found out that this ingredient is gentle on the skin, making it suitable for most skin types. Overall, incorporating products containing azelaic acid into your skincare routine could be a great way to combat hyperpigmentation and achieve a more balanced complexion.
